Transaction d76520cf337ad11e5e6226e1784b70ded1cfe8ed32cc8603f368d8a10e4b79b3
1 Input
1 Output
-
d76520cf337ad11e5e6226e1784b70ded1cfe8ed32cc8603f368d8a10e4b79b3:0
- value
- 85574
- script pubkey
- OP_0 OP_PUSHBYTES_20 3944b32cbda794304d7a50d1db7662d9b1bdcecb
- address
- bc1q89ztxt9a572rqnt62rgakanzmxcmmnkt29yqj9